Course Overview
Fire 2088 provides an overview of the techniques, routines and solutions for test, inspect and maintenance on special fire suppression systems. Included in this course are a variety of extinguishing agents and the appropriate hardware that stores and issues the agents upon being triggered by a fire situation. The systems utilize extinguishing agents such as carbon dioxide, dry chemical, wet chemical, low, medium and high expansion foam, and water mist. Discussion and quizzes will reinforce the learning outcomes as the course progresses. Upon completion, students will be eligible to register at the Applied Science Technologists and Technicians of BC (ASTTBC) in pre-engineered special suppression systems.

Learning Outcomes
Upon successful completion of this course, the student will be able to:
- Describe what constitutes a special fire suppression system
- Explain fire development theory and fire behaviour.
- Differentiate various fire suppressions systems
- Recognize the different types of fire suppression agents
- Recognize the appropriate applications for fire suppression systems
- Apply appropriate installation standards for suppression system detectors
- Explain the various codes and standards that govern installation
- Appreciate the importance of testing and inspection of fire suppression systems
- Examine the associated hazards and dangers of the fire suppression agents
